A study showed that the ordinary Malaysian drinks 2.38 cup of coffee daily. Coffee alcohol consumption culture has actually been grown by the ongoing expansion of retail cafe companies of both international brand names such as Starbucks, Coffee Bean & Tea Leaf that bring in the "cafe society" from the West and various other residential brands such as Chinese Kopitiam, Old Town White Coffee that build on the regional coffee-shop society.
